According to a BBC poll, Britons believe that race relations are so poor that they are likely to spill into violence any moment. Almost two-thirds of people in Britain fear the impact of poor race relations, and most believe that the country has too many immigrants. Half of those polled wanted foreigners to be encouraged to leave the country.

Biles, the world's most decorated gymnast, returned for her third Olympics after she abruptly pulled out from the team final at the Tokyo Games suffering from the "twisties", a term used to describe the temporary loss of spatial awareness while performing high-difficulty elements.
